New Nassau Napoleonic Army 1806-07
28mm figures designed by Alan Perry
These are now available on our website
NN 15 Lieb battalion v. Todenwarth, command (helmets) 1806-07
NN16 Lieb battalion v. Todenwarth, marching (helmets) 1806-07
NN 17 2nd and 4th battalions v. Kruse and v. Holbach, command (shako) 1806-07
NN 18 2nd and 4th battalion s v. Kruse and v. Holbach, marching (shako) 1806-07
NN 19 4th battalion v. Holbach, grenadiers (shako, large plume) 1806-07
NN 20 3rd battalion v. Schaeffer, command (jaegers) 1806-07
NN 21 3rd battalion v. Schaeffer, marching (jaegers) 1806-07
NN 22 3rd battalion v. Schaeffer, schutzen (sharpshooters)/NCO’s (jaegers) 1806-07
